Method

Preparation of Patties

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ground Beef

    In a mixing bowl, combine the ground beef with salt and black pepper. Mix gently to avoid overworking the meat.

  2. 2

    Form the Patties

    Divide the seasoned ground beef into four equal portions and shape each portion into a round patty, about 3/4 inch thick.

Grilling

  1. 3

    Preheat the Grill

    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(about 375°F to 400°F).

  2. 4

    Grill the Patties

    Place the beef patties on the grill and cook for about 4-5 minutes on one side. Flip the patties and place a slice of cheddar cheese on each patty. Cook for another 4-5 minutes or until the cheese is melted and the patties are cooked to your desired doneness.

Assembling the Burger

  1. 5

    Prepare the Buns

    While the patties are grilling, slice the burger buns in half and toast them lightly on the grill for about 1-2 minutes.

  2. 6

    Add Toppings

    On the bottom half of each bun, place a lettuce leaf, followed by a grilled patty with melted cheddar, a slice of tomato (sliced from the medium tomato), and any optional condiments such as ketchup or mustard.

  3. 7

    Finish and Serve

    Top with the other half of the bun, secure with a skewer if needed, and serve immediately while hot.
